在编写Django项目时会遇到问题:
- Django1.x中外键的实现不需要传递on_delete属性的值, 默认就是级联删除。
dev_info = models.ForeignKey('NetWorkInfo')
- Django2.x中外键的实现需要传递on_delete属性的值, 否则会报错。
dev_info = models.ForeignKey('NetWorkInfo', on_delete=models.CASCADE)
需求: Pycharm中使用正则的分组匹配来进行批量替换。
- (.*?): 括号是正则分组, 第几个括号就是第几个分组。